diff --git a/iRLeagueManager/ViewModels/ReviewCommentViewModel.cs b/iRLeagueManager/ViewModels/ReviewCommentViewModel.cs index 49b070d..b59ff9c 100644 --- a/iRLeagueManager/ViewModels/ReviewCommentViewModel.cs +++ b/iRLeagueManager/ViewModels/ReviewCommentViewModel.cs @@ -14,6 +14,7 @@ using System.Threading.Tasks; using System.Windows; using System.Windows.Input; +using System.Runtime.CompilerServices; namespace iRLeagueManager.ViewModels { @@ -87,6 +88,18 @@ public async override void SaveChanges() public ReviewCommentViewModel(ReviewCommentModel comment) : base(comment) { } + protected override void OnPropertyChanged([CallerMemberName] string propertyName = "") + { + switch(propertyName) + { + case nameof(Model.CommentReviewVotes): + base.OnPropertyChanged(nameof(Votes)); + break; + } + + base.OnPropertyChanged(propertyName); + } + public new ReviewCommentModel GetSource() { return base.GetSource() as ReviewCommentModel;